 I'm also against automagically (and silently) fixing perceived network
 problems.  And worse, making the changes silently permanent.
 
 Why not, instead, tell users that they can disable IP protocols with
 qemu's "-nic user,.." option and point them to TFM.
 
 The very first example at
 https://www.qemu.org/docs/master/system/invocation.html#sec-005finvocation
 shows how to disable IPv6.
